I'd go for the dns3500, this CD player is new to the industry came out only a few months ago so far I've read enough good reviews to consider buying it myself so I am saving up for one now. It's perfect for scratching (direct drive motor) long mixing 0.02 pitch resolution However eventhough it supports MP3 discs it does play mp3 files but the features like stutter and effects do not work with VBR files, people are experiencing some problems with things like the CUE point moves, some mentioned that the track would jump to the beginning during playback, those are serious issues so guys from Denon are aware of them and are developing a software update.
